Chamber available at low cost
Unfortunately, the centre in Grimsby which was one of the first ones providing oxygen treatment in the community in England closed end of May. It would be very sad to see a perfect chamber which could help so many people go to the scrapyard.
The chamber has to be moved out of the centre within 6-8 weeks (around mid July). It has been fully serviced in April by Diveline and the centre only wants to be paid for the dismantling costs. The chamber and all the equipment itself was valued at £30,000 but only having to pay the dismantling and transport costs would be a great bargain.
Please let us know as soon as possible if you are interested and can provide this lovely chamber with a new home.

Trevor Callaway
by Bruce Laidlaw, ChairmanIt is with great sadness that we learnt of the death of Trevor Callaway. Not many of the current members of the Therapy Centre will realise the debt they and the Centre owe to Trevor. Back in 1995 the Therapy Centre was in considerable financial difficulty and it was Trevor who personally negotiated a £20,000 grant for the Centre from Lothian Health Board. Without this money the Centre would have closed, and we still receive this grant each year. In addition to his fundraising expertise Trevor was a great person to have with you in a crisis. His enthusiasm and commitment to the Centre was uncompromising and although he always dealt with matters in a very serious and businesslike fashion behind this earnest exterior lay a great and, at times, wicked sense of humour.
There is to be a collection at his funeral in support of Leuchie House Respite Centre which Trevor used a lot latterly. This is typical Trevor, fundraising to the last. Our thoughts are with his wife Jeanette.

Enewsletter from MS Resource Centre: focus on CCSVI
The regular enewsletter from the MSRC is headlined by news relating to CCSVI (Chronic Cerebrospinal Venous Insufficiency) and they have a new section on their website to keep users up to date. The first preliminary results have been reported by the clinical studies underway and there is a petition to sign asking for research to be carried out in the UK. Users can also register their interest in possible CCSVI scanning at one of Dr Tom Gilhooly's clinics.
